Baked apples with cinnamon

2 servings

50 minutes

Baked apples with cinnamon are a simple yet incredibly aromatic dish that warms the soul and evokes cozy evenings. This recipe has Mexican roots where spices play a key role in cooking. Sweet, soft apples soaked in a delicate syrup of cinnamon and powdered sugar create a harmony of flavors – simultaneously tart, sweet, and warming. The dish is perfect for cold days, and its appetizing aroma makes it a desirable dessert in any home. Baked apples can be served on their own or complemented with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for a contrast of temperatures and textures. This dessert is not only delicious but also healthy as apples are rich in vitamins and fiber while cinnamon helps improve metabolism.

Ingredients
2servings
Apple
2 
pc
Ground cinnamon
1 
tsp
Water
0.3 
glass
Powdered sugar
0.5 
glass
Cooking steps
  • 1

    Wash the apples, remove the core and seeds, and place them in a mold.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Apple2 pieces
  • 2

    Make syrup: mix powdered sugar, cinnamon, and hot water.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Powdered sugar0.5 glass
    2. Ground cinnamon1 teaspoon
    3. Water0.3 glass
  • 3

    Pour syrup beautifully over apples directly in the shape.

    Required ingredients:
    1. Powdered sugar0.5 glass
    2. Ground cinnamon1 teaspoon
    3. Water0.3 glass
  • 4

    Place in an oven preheated to 180 degrees for 30-40 minutes (depending on the size and variety of apples).

  • 5

    Sprinkle the prepared apples with powdered sugar. Serve hot.
